A cylindrical extrusion process invented by Alex Doumak in 1948 gives marshmallows their s'mores-friendly shape. After being roasted over an open fire to a golden brown or charcoal black, the hot marshmallow melts the chocolate and secures the sandwich. AFLAME BLACKENED Allowing your campfire to mellow to a mound of glowing embers will heat the marshmallow throughout for a hot creamy texture, sealed with a light brown crust. WELL DONE MEDIUM A young dancing flame will quickly sear the marshmallow coating, keeping the interior cool and firm.
